California Primary Election: Poll Hours and Result Timing
AFBytes Brief
California voters head to the polls for the 2026 primary with closing time set at 8 p.m. State officials note that full results certification often requires several days.
Why this matters
Delayed election results in the most populous state affect national perceptions of electoral efficiency and candidate momentum.
